SMTP(简单邮件传输协议)是电子邮件系统中最重要的组成部分之一,它负责在不同主机之间发送和接收邮件。随着网络安全威胁的不断增加,确保SMTP服务器的安全性已成为企业、组织和个人用户面临的重要挑战。
1. 使用加密技术
TLS/SSL加密: 为避免邮件内容被窃取或篡改,建议使用TLS(传输层安全)或SSL(安全套接字层)协议对SMTP通信进行加密。当客户端与服务器建立连接时,双方会协商一种加密算法,并交换密钥以确保信息传输过程中的保密性和完整性。
S/MIME或PGP加密: 还可以考虑采用S/MIME(安全多用途互联网邮件扩展)或PGP(Pretty Good Privacy)等公钥基础设施(PKI)来保护电子邮件的内容。通过这种方式,只有拥有正确私钥的人才能读取已加密的信息。
2. 配置身份验证机制
为了防止未经授权访问您的SMTP服务器并利用其发送垃圾邮件或其他恶意消息,您需要设置适当的身份验证措施。常见的方法包括:
- 用户名/密码组合:要求发件人在提交新邮件之前提供有效的登录凭证。
- 双因素认证(2FA):除了常规的账号密码之外,还需额外输入一次性验证码,通常通过手机短信、应用程序生成或者硬件令牌等方式获取。
- OAuth 2.0:这是一种现代的身份验证框架,允许第三方服务代表用户授权访问资源而无需共享实际密码。
3. 实施SPF、DKIM及DMARC策略
为了减少钓鱼攻击和伪造电子邮件的风险,您可以启用以下三项关键技术:
- SPF(Sender Policy Framework): 定义了哪些IP地址被授权代表特定域名发送邮件,从而有效阻止伪造者冒充合法来源。
- DKIM(DomainKeys Identified Mail): 利用非对称加密技术,在每封邮件上附加数字签名,以便收件方能够验证其来源的真实性。
- DMARC(Domain-based Message Authentication, Reporting & Conformance): 建立了一种反馈机制,让管理员可以监控来自他们自己域的可疑活动,并根据情况采取相应行动。
4. 定期更新软件版本
无论是操作系统还是邮件服务器本身,都可能存在未知漏洞。请务必定期检查官方渠道发布的最新补丁程序,并及时应用到生产环境中。还应关注相关社区论坛和技术博客,了解行业内最新的安全趋势和发展动态。
5. 监控日志记录与异常行为检测
最后但同样重要的是,保持良好的日志管理习惯对于维护SMTP服务器的安全至关重要。通过收集和分析各种类型的日志数据(如连接请求、登录尝试、邮件流量等),可以帮助我们快速发现潜在问题并作出反应。结合机器学习算法实现智能化的异常行为检测,进一步增强系统的自适应防护能力。
提高SMTP服务器的安全性是一项持续不断的努力过程。通过采用上述措施,我们可以大大降低邮件被拦截或篡改的可能性,从而保障通信内容的机密性和完整性。这只是一个开始,随着技术的进步和社会环境的变化,我们需要始终保持着警惕的态度,积极应对可能出现的新威胁。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/76961.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。